Viewed: 43 - Published at: 6 years agoIngredients
- 1 - 1 1/2 lb boneless chicken, cut up
- 1 cup white onion (you can leave the chunks big so you can pick them out)
- 12 ounces diet orange soda (Diet Rite Tangerine works great)
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ce
- 2 tablespoons white vinegar
- 1 teaspoon ground ginger
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
- black pepper, to taste
Method
- Brown chicken and onions in a non-stick pan sprayed with cooking spray.
- When chicken is brown, add the remaining ingredients.
- Cover and simmer for about 20 minutes until the chicken is tender and thoroughly cooked.
- Uncover and reduce liquid until it makes a syrupy sauce.
- A little arrowroot powder may be added to thicken the sauce, if desired.
